Class of 2027 Women's Lacrosse Commits
2,390 tracked NCAA and NAIA commits from the girls' lacrosse class of 2027, landing at 396 schools. 43% went to D1 programs and 30% to D3. FL Southern took the most players from this class (15). New York produced the most commits (465). This is a count of where the class went, not a list of who went. Player-level records stay inside the product.

How this page is built
Every row in our commitment data is one player, one college, one graduating class. This page counts the class of 2027rows we can join to a college in our database and groups them by the division of that program, the program itself, the club recorded with the commit and the player's home state. Commits we cannot match to a school are left out, so the totals run a little below the true number. Nothing here is a ranking of players.
